Compartilhar via


How to Connect to a Target Device for Debugging

Windows Mobile SupportedWindows Embedded CE Supported

9/8/2008

Você pode estabelecer uma conexão de Platform Builder para um dispositivo –powered Windows Embedded CE para depuração dispositivo de destino.

Se a executar-imagem tempo inclui a biblioteca Kdstub.dll para o depurador kernel, você pode usar o depurador kernel no dispositivo de destino.

Etapas

Etapa Tópico

1. Use o Windows Embedded CE OS Design Wizard para selecionar um modelo design e os componentes iniciais para o design OS.

Creating an OS Design with the Windows Embedded CE OS Design Wizard

2. Familiarize-se com o nível de suporte para depuração em cada configuração que fornece Windows Embedded.

Build Configurations

3. Escolha uma configuração de depuração ou de versão para destino quando Platform Builder cria o design OS em um executar-imagem tempo.

Para usar o depurador kernel, verifique se que suporte para o depurador kernel está habilitado.

Levels of Debugging Support

Building a Run-Time Image From a Debug Configuration

Building a Run-Time Image From a Release Configuration

4. Promover um design OS um executar-imagem tempo.

Building a Run-Time Image

5. In a Saída janela, na Saída Guia, verificar que a compilar não possua erros.

Build Error Debugging Process

6. Em Platform Builder, aberto a executar-imagem tempo criado na etapa 4.

Opening a Run-time Image for Debugging

7. Escolha um serviço baixar apropriado para o hardware conexão. O serviço baixar irá baixar um executar-imagem tempo ao dispositivo de destino.

Download Service Selection

8. Configurar o hardware conexão exigido para o serviço baixar. Esse hardware conecta-se o dispositivo destino a estação de trabalho de desenvolvimento, na qual o Platform Builder está instalado. Exemplos de hardware conexão incluem cabos, um hub ou adaptadores rede Ethernet.

Hardware Configuration

9. Se você selecionou serial Service download na etapa 7, configurar o terminal do HyperTerminal aplicativo de Emulação para exibir o serial saída depuração a Partir de porta serial no dispositivo de destino.

Esta configuração requer um NULL - modem cabo conectado a um porta serial, such as COM1.

Configuring HyperTerminal for BSPs

10. Ativar dispositivo de destino para que ele se torna ativo de rede Ethernet ou sobre o serial conexão e Platform Builder podem descobri-lo.

Não aplicável

11. Configure a conexão ao dispositivo de destino.

Escolha o apropriado tópico baseia se estação de trabalho o desenvolvimento e o dispositivo destino são conectados por uma rede Ethernet ou uma conexão porta serial.

Configuring an Ethernet Remote Connection

Configuring a Serial Remote Connection

12. Baixe o executar-imagem tempo para o dispositivo destino através de conexão configurado.

Downloading a Run-Time Image

13. Verificar que o depurador kernel se conecta ao dispositivo de destino.

Quando se Conecta o depurador kernel, depuração as mensagens são exibidas na Saída exibição das Saída janela em Platform Builder.

Depois de estabelecer uma conexão entre Platform Builder e dispositivo de destino, o depurador kernel coleta dados do dispositivo de destino.

Debugger Execution Control

Viewing Debug Information in the Debug Windows

Breakpoints

See Also

Other Resources

Diagnostics and Debugging for Mobile and Embedded Development